How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Nichols?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Nichols Studio Apartments | $2,390 | $1,450 | $2,978 |
| Nichols 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,714 | $1,425 | $5,193 |
| Nichols 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,357 | $1,450 | $5,356 |
| Nichols 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,752 | $2,395 | $6,612 |
| Nichols 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,064 | $2,295 | $3,995 |
